Separation Seal (Contacting Technology) is83
The is83 is a dual-segmented carbon bushing assembly designed to prevent the migration of bearing oil to the dry gas seal cartridge. Normally applied as a double arrangement with an inert buffer gas. When used in conjunction with the is28 dry-running gas seal, it provides a total sealing system that ensures separation of bearing oil and process gas in compressors.
Technical Description Mechanical seal IS83
The is83 is a contacting carbon bushing designed to isolate the bearing oil from the dry gas seal cartridge.
Normally supplied as a complete seal cartridge, unique inner and outer segments are specifically designed to prevent oil migration and minimize wear.
Nitrogen is normally injected between the two segmented bushings effectively creating a pressure barrier between the bearing and DGS cavity.
Advanced materials and design ensure minimal wear and promote long life. Unlike many contacting separation seals the is83 is designed to operate on cryogenic ally dry nitrogen.

Features is83

Low buffer gas consumption.
Low wear for longer life and improved reliability.
Cartridge design for easy installation.
Universal design independent of shaft rotation.
Unique carbon bushing segment design with self-adjusting hydropads.
Incorporates biased flow path to further reduce the risk of bearing oil migration.
Specially designed joint between the carbon bushing segments to minimize buffer consumption and bearing oil migration.
Unique axial spring design accommodates shaft excursions.
